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Problem: Losing car keys can be a stressful and troublesome experience. It can leave you stranded and susceptible to theft.Option: A local locksmith can create a brand-new set of keys based on your car's make, model, and year. They can likewise program new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Issue: Accidentally locking your keys in the car can be an aggravating circumstance, specifically if you need to get someplace quickly.Service: A locksmith can quickly and efficiently unlock your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and strategies to get entry safely.
Jammed Ignition
Problem: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Solution: A locksmith can identify the concern and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can likewise provide ideas to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Issue: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it difficult to lock or open the doors.Option: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to ensure that all locks are synchronized and safe.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ions
Issue: Modern automobiles frequently feature keyless entry systems, which can malfunction due to battery issues or signal disturbance.Solution: A locksmith can troubleshoot and repair keyless entry systems, ensuring they work effectively.Benefits of Using a Local Locksmith for Car Services

Q1: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The cost can differ depending upon the type of key and the intricacy of the car's locking system. Usually, an easy key duplication can cost between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
A2: Yes, professional locksmith professionals are trained to use non-destructive techniques to unlock cars. They use specialized tools to get ent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I require to stick with my car while the locksmith works?
A3: It is usually recommended to stick with your car while the locksmith works, particularly if the issue involves keys or locks. This makes sure that you exist to license the work and confirm that whatever is done properly.
Q4: How long does it consider a locksmith to arrive?
A4: The response time can vary, but numerous local locksmith for car locksmith professionals offer 30-minute to 1-hour response times. If you need immediate support, try to find a locksmith who supplies emergency situation services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can likewise rekey your ignition lock cylinder to make sure that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mith professionals legally allowed to work on car locks?
A6: Yes, licensed locksmith professionals are legally enabled to deal with car locks. They need to adhere to stringent guidelines and requirements to ensure the security and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to eliminate it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and expertise to extract the broken key without harming the lock.
